Benefits of Foot Valves, Water Pump Strainers, and Skimmers

Foot valves are essential for preventing backflow, ensuring that pumps remain primed and ready for operation. By maintaining a one-way flow of fluid, they help reduce system downtime and protect pumps from dry running, which can cause significant damage over time.

Water pump strainers act as the first line of defense against debris and contaminants, preventing clogging and pump wear. By filtering out particles before they enter the system, strainers extend pump lifespan, minimize maintenance, and improve overall system efficiency.

Skimmers play a crucial role in maintaining clean water flow, especially in demanding industrial and agricultural applications. By removing floating debris and surface contaminants, skimmers help improve water quality and prevent buildup that could affect pump performance.

Cast Iron Construction and NPT Threading for Secure Installation

Built for strength and durability, our painted cast iron foot valves and strainers withstand the harsh conditions of industrial environments. Cast iron is known for its high corrosion resistance and ability to handle extreme pressure, making it an ideal material for long-lasting hydraulic components. The protective paint coating further enhances resistance to rust and wear, ensuring reliable performance in demanding applications.

For a secure, leak-free connection, these components feature NPT (National Pipe Taper) threading, which creates a tight, pressure-resistant seal when installed. NPT threading is widely used in hydraulic and water pump systems because of its self-sealing design, reducing the risk of leaks and making installation easier and more reliable.

Foot Valves, Water Pump Strainers, and Skimmers FAQs

What is the purpose of a foot valve in a hydraulic or water pump system?

A foot valve is a one-way check valve installed at the pump’s inlet to prevent backflow and keep the system primed. This ensures consistent pump operation and helps avoid dry running, which can cause damage to the pump.


How do water pump strainers protect pumps and prevent system damage?

Water pump strainers filter out debris and contaminants before they enter the pump, preventing clogs, wear, and mechanical failure. By maintaining clean fluid flow, strainers extend pump lifespan and reduce maintenance costs.
